The Role of Virtual and Augmented Reality

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R) are foundational to the revolution. VR offers complete immersion, transporting players to meticulously crafted digital environments that mimic – or even surpass – the glamour of real-world casinos. Players can interact with these spaces using controllers or motion tracking, creating a sensation of genuine presence. AR, on the other hand, blends the digital and physical worlds, overlaying game elements onto the player’s existing surroundings. Imagine playing virtual blackjack on your kitchen table, or exploring a digital slot machine that appears to materialize in your living room.

Developing Realistic VR Casino Environments

Creating truly engaging VR casino experiences isn't just about high-resolution graphics. It demands a comprehensive understanding of human psychology and the nuances of social interaction. Developers are focusing on creating believable non-player characters (NPCs) that can mimic human behavior, from subtle facial expressions to realistic conversational patterns. The goal is to foster a sense of community within the virtual space, even when players are physically isolated. Furthermore, considerations like minimizing motion sickness and optimizing for varying hardware configurations are critical for ensuring accessibility and a comfortable experience for a broad audience. Sophisticated sound design is also essential; positional audio cues and reactive soundscapes can significantly enhance the feeling of immersion.

Blockchain Technology and Secure Transactions

Security and transparency are paramount in the gaming industry, and blockchain technology offers promising solutions. By using a decentralized ledger, blockchain can ensure the integrity of game outcomes, prevent fraud, and streamline payment processes. Cryptocurrencies, built upon blockchain technology, provide a secure and anonymous way for players to deposit and withdraw funds. This is particularly appealing to players who are concerned about data privacy or who reside in jurisdictions with restrictive financial regulations. Smart contracts, automated agreements written into the blockchain, can ensure fair payouts and eliminate the need for intermediaries.

Enhancing Trust and Transparency

The inherent transparency of blockchain technology also helps build trust between players and the casino operator. Players can independently verify the fairness of game outcomes, eliminating any suspicion of manipulation. This increased trust can attract new players and foster a more positive gaming experience. Furthermore, blockchain-based loyalty programs can reward players with unique digital assets – non-fungible tokens (NFTs) – that represent exclusive benefits or in-game items. These NFTs can be traded or sold, adding another layer of value to the gaming experience. Future Trends: Biofeedback and Neurogaming

Looking ahead, the future of gaming promises even more immersive and personalized experiences. Emerging technologies like biofeedback and neurogaming have the potential to revolutionize how we interact with games. Biofeedback involves using sensors to monitor physiological signals – such as heart rate, skin conductance, and brain activity – and then using that data to adapt the game experience. For example, a poker game could adjust its difficulty level based on your stress levels, or a slot machine could offer bonus rounds when you’re feeling particularly lucky.

Neurogaming takes this a step further, using brain-computer interfaces (BCIs) to directly translate your thoughts and intentions into game actions. Imagine controlling a virtual slot machine with just your mind, or influencing the outcome of a poker hand with your focus and concentration. While still in its early stages of development, neurogaming holds immense potential for creating truly mind-bending gaming experiences.
